Overview
In this 7 hr course, you will explore the modern features and best practices of programming in C++. Learn about modules, concepts, ranges, coroutines, and concurrent programming to write clean and performant code effectively.
What I will be able to do after this course
- Master best practices in modern C++ programming.
- Gain proficiency with recent features like modules, concepts, and coroutines.
- Understand and apply the C++ Core Guidelines.
- Develop clean and maintainable software using modern standards.
- Enhance skills in concurrent and parallel programming techniques.
Course Instructor(s)
Georgy Pashkov, a highly experienced C++ instructor and enthusiast, brings years of hands-on programming experience and a passion for teaching. Having delved deeply into modern C++ standards, Georgy thrives on sharing both the technical intricacies and practical insights that empower learners to excel. Join Georgy to learn C++ the smart and effective way!
Who is it for?
This course is designed for C++ developers who wish to advance their knowledge and adopt modern C++ paradigms. It is ideal for learners familiar with C++11 features and looking to master the capabilities of C++17 and C++20. Aspiring to write efficient, maintainable, and modern C++ code should intrigue professionals to pick up this course.